Project 2010—KB 2596495

• 30813 – After changing data on a project that has many tasks in it, it can take multiple seconds for Project to recalculate and give control back to the user

• 30828 – The finish date for a deliverable dependency is displayed incorrectly in the tooltip. This is a follow-up to fix 28970

• 30898 - Project stops responding when you open projects that have bad manually scheduled task dates

• 30907 - The background color and patterns in the Network Diagram view do not render correctly when they are printed or previewed

Project 2010—KB 2596495

• 30982 – Projects from Project 2007 may not open correctly in Project 2010 if custom Duration fields have been defined

• 30990 – Modifying time-phased work in Project Professional moves actual work; additionally, the "Out of Sync" message does not occur

• 31069 – If you print an MPP file directly from Windows Explorer, the process fails, and you receive the message "An unexpected error."

• 31129 - Sync to Protected Actuals on a completed zero work task causes the task start date to revert to NA; this leads to a Reporting (Project Publish) queue job failure

Project 2010—KB 2596495

• 31136 – Deliverables fail to update correctly if there are more than 159 deliverables in one project

• 31241 – When paste-links are reestablished, custom field lookup table values may be lost

• Office - KB 2596585– After showing a VBA form, Project may crash

when the project is saved (usually on or after the second save)

Project Server 2010—KB 2596498

• 30738 – In the Approval Center, the last sent updates are displayed in red, now matching the Project Server 2007 behavior

• 30887 – In Project Web App (PWA), creating a new project from a template ignores the “Active” task flag

• 30906 - When a status manager accepts updates, entering too many characters into the comments window causes an error, and the update is not applied and is lost

• 30924 - Accepting assignment updates may zero out work and duration values on incomplete fixed-duration tasks

Project Server 2010—KB 2596498

• 30964 – A large volume of shadow table records created by Project Server leads to performance problems in Project Professional. Note: There may still be issues when custom flag fields are involved

• 30966 – While in a timesheet, information in the "Task hierarchy“ field does not immediately display

• 30995 – Custom field information from a timesheet is lost after importing into My Tasks; The same issue was addressed in Project Server 2007 in fix 27626

• 31073 – In the Approval Center, assignments that have enterprise custom fields with lookup tables may appear even though the assignment hasn’t been changed

Project Server 2010—KB 2596498

• 31115 – Tasks that are closed are incorrectly removed from a user’s timesheet

• 31116 – When grouping is applied in a timesheet, an extra grouping row is added, making the view very cluttered

• 31122 – Material and other such assignments don't appear on team members’ task lists; Also, the New Tasks reminder counts incorrectly

• 31145 – The Timesheet created event is triggered before the assignments have been added and saved

• 31562 – In previous cumulative updates, database changes may not have been applied

Project 2007—KB 2596533

• 30254 – Custom fields set into a project via the PSI may not be there or may be wrong when the project is opened in Project Professional

• 31232 – Project may crash when a bottom pane of a split view is set to the Resource Graph and the project is a master project

Project Server 2007—KB 2596542

• 30388 – A large volume of shadow table records created by Project Server leads to performance problems in Project Professional; This is the same issue as in Project Server 2010

• 31105 – A resource plan gets checked in before saving, which leads to an error that it is not checked out to you and blocks further use of the build team functionality

• 31118 – The numbered week time dimension in the OLAP cube doesn’t sort correctly in places like a Data Analysis view

Project 2007 Service Pack 3—KB 923622 and 2526299

• Contains all updates up to the August 2011 cumulative update– Primarily a cumulative update rollup plus

security fixes• Client fixes: KB 938797

• Can be loaded either before or after the October 2011 cumulative update

High-Level Software Update Steps

Resources:• Update Center for Microsoft Office, Office Servers, and related products: http://

technet.microsoft.com/en-us/office/ee748587.aspx

• Deploy Project Server 2007 and Project Server 2010 updates • TechNet articlesSteps:• Preparation:

– Complete software update signoff in a test environment– Back up your environment because you cannot remove an update– Create a single deployment package (slipstream)

• Installation:– Windows SharePoint Services– Server rollup packages– 2007: Microsoft Office SharePoint Server 2007 Cumulative Update Server Hotfix Package (includes

Project Server) – 2010: Microsoft SharePoint Server 2010 and Project Server 2010 Cumulative Update Server Hotfix

Package  – Language packs (if needed)– SharePoint Server 2007 and SharePoint Server 2010 language pack– Repeat the steps above for each server in your farm– Run the SharePoint Products and Technologies Configuration Wizard– Deploy the Project desktop update

• Verification:– Review the ULS logs (C: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\Web server extensions\

{version}\LOGS)– Verify the product version in Add or Remove Programs/Programs and Features– Verify the database version
